Basically just parroting what @rayryeng has said in his comment, but a small self-contained example to find the partial derivative of y (x, z) = x^2 + z^2 with respect to x: pkg load symbolic syms x z y = x^2 + z^2 diff (y, x) Gives the result: ans = (sym) 2*x. Which is the correct partial derivative of y with respect to x.

When dealing with partial … results and payouts soccer sixWebFirst, take the partial derivative of z with respect to x. Then take the derivative again, but this time, take it with respect to y, and hold the x constant. Spatially, think of the cross partial as a measure of how the slope (change in z with respect to x) changes, when the y … results and fixtures tennis westWebSep 8, 2015 · I am trying to write a user-defined function in Excel to calculate the partial derivative of a function, f(x, y,...n), with respect to, x.
